CVE-2017-10688: In LibTIFF 4.0.8, there is a assertion abort in the TIFFWriteDirectoryTagCheckedLong8Array function in tif_...

In LibTIFF 4.0.8, there is a assertion abort in the TIFFWriteDirectoryTagCheckedLong8Array function in tif_dirwrite.c. A crafted input will lead to a remote denial of service attack.

CVE-2017-10688 is a LibTIFF 4.0.8 flaw where a specially crafted TIFF input can crash software that processes it. The main business risk is denial of service in applications, servers, or workflows that automatically ingest images from untrusted sources. Exposure is most likely where LibTIFF 4.0.8 is used by image upload, conversion, document-processing, scanning, or media pipelines that accept TIFF files from users or external systems. Treat this as a practical availability risk, not confirmed widespread exploitation. Prioritize internet-facing or automated image-processing systems first, especially where a crash could interrupt customer workflows or operational pipelines. Mitigation focus: Apply relevant LibTIFF updates from your OS or application vendor.; Review Ubuntu USN-3602-1 and Debian DSA-3903 where applicable.; Reduce or disable untrusted TIFF processing where it is not required..
